Welcome to Ironworks. Nightcloak! As Brainless One said, Katanas are one-handed. They are also quite rare, especially magical ones. By the way, you can't have a Kensai/Monk - that's an illegal combination. You could have a Kensai/Thief, but it would have to be dual class not multiclass. You can dual from a kit to a class, but not from a class to a kit or kit to a kit.
